Is accomplished, as a rule, via a manually adjustable
1, 2 or 3 potentiometers, primitively designed minimal electronics
in a plastic box.
These devices have no engine or vehicle specific fuel
map, but are equipped only with a basic electronics that manipulates
the control signals sent to the injection pump.
1 or 2 potentiometers are used to adjust the power increase
in the lower and/or upper speed range the third potentiometer is used to
influence the overall setting and the smoke emission

Analogue diesel boxes cannot be optimally adjusted throughout
the total range. They are usually adjusted too rich in sub ranges. The
engines consume too much fuel and emit un-burnt diesel resulting in large
clouds of black smoke while accelerating.
